ROLE DESCRIPTION
The Director of Operations provides strategic leadership and management of the College's operational systems. This role ensures that timetables, daily operations, events, compliance processes and administrative systems run efficiently, supporting the smooth delivery of teaching, learning and externally based programs. This role has a 10-year Tenure.
Key Responsibilities
Operational Management
Prepare staffing, rooming, and supervision plans for NAPLAN, OLNA, Progressive Achievement Testing, PISA and TIMMS testing, ATAR exams and other major assessments.
Be present at the start of all key testing events ensuring that expectations are met
Work with Relief Co-Ordinator to manage relief staffing and make adjustments where necessary
Manage staff rosters and duty allocations
Oversee timetable adjustments and room allocations
Lead the development, maintenance and review of the College timetable, ensuring alignment with enrolments, subject selection, class size, staffing and College priorities (*Please note that you are not required to create the College timetable but will be required to liaise with the timetable and to have an understanding of the timetable so that adjustments can be made where necessary).
Ensure prompt updates for new enrolments, course changes and House/Home Room assignments.
Management of key College staff.
Administration
Ensure compliance with CEWA, Catholic Education Commission and government requirements.
Check updates to/edit the College's social media publications and other correspondence that comes from Nagle.
Event & Program Coordination
Oversee Parent/Student/Teacher Interviews, including scheduling, communications and logistics.
Organise roster for staff supervision for PST Interviews and any other Curriculum Leadership Team supervision.
Manage photography days, including liaison with Marketing Manager, photographers and distribution of photos.
Careers & Pathways
Lead Careers education programs and oversee VET pathways, work experience and post-school transition planning.
Build partnerships with universities, training providers and industry to expand opportunities for students.
Oversee the UniReady in Schools Program.
Oversee the ViSN program in schools
Counsel students with regard to their careers and pathways
Learning Support Coordination
Oversee the organisation and review of Individual Education Plans (IEPs), ensuring documentation of adjustments for students with additional needs.
Coordinate communication between Learning Support, students, families and external agencies.
Other duties as assigned by the Principal
ESSENTIAL REQUIREMENTS
Educational background: Senior teaching qualification and substantial leadership experience
Strong organisational expertise: Proficiency with data systems and software and a willingness to develop skills in Edval
Excellent communication and leadership skills: The role involves coordinating with various stakeholders and leading operations across the school
Have completed Accreditation to Teach in a Catholic School, or willing to complete
Have completed Accreditation for Middle Leadership in a Catholic School, or willing to complete
Current registration with Teachers Registration Board WA
Current Working With Children Check
